What drives eviction risk in Willow Village
Running hot, court filing pressure reads 8.9/10. It sits 1.7 points above the Washtenaw County average of 5.0.
Against Washtenaw County at 46.5%, 38% of renters here are cost-burdened. On the high side, housing-court posture reads 8.1/10.
14% are severely burdened past the 50% mark. That cohort absorbs no shock: one repair bill or one cut shift converts straight into arrears. Average gross rent is $1,270, 18% above the Ypsilanti average.
The filing record is not thin: 99 evictions over 1 years of observation. Filings peaked in 2014 at 21.6% of renter households. In a typical year about 21.6% of renter households face a filing.
On the national scale it lands near the 83rd percentile of the 84,120 tracts scored. Social vulnerability reads 6.3/10 on the CDC index, a measure of exposure to housing and economic shocks.
Statewide the MI average is 4.2, so this tract runs 2.5 points hotter.
